| Obverse description | Laureate head of Apollo facing right, rendered in fine archaic-transitional style with carefully engraved wavy hair gathered at the crown and secured with a laurel wreath, the locks falling in tightly articulated waves behind the neck. The portrait displays a strong, idealised profile with a prominent nose, well-defined lips, and a sharp jaw, characteristic of the high artistic output of the Damastion mint. The surface of the field is plain and unlettered, with the portrait positioned centrally and commanding the full flan. |

| Reverse description | A tripod lebes with two prominent legs and a cauldron rendered in high relief occupies the centre of the field, flanked by the ethnic legend of the Damastinoi arranged around the design. The inscription ΔΑΜΑΣΤΙΝΩΝ runs horizontally along the base of the tripod in bold Greek letters, while KΗΦΙ appears vertically to the left, referencing the magistrate or engraver Kephisophon. The overall design is bold and schematic, typical of the coinage of the silver-rich mining community of Damastion, with the tripod serving as the city's principal reverse type throughout its coinage. |
